Two Men Sentenced 25 Years for Iran-Backed Plot to Murder US Journalist
Two men, Rafat Amirov and Polad Omarov, were sentenced to 25 years in prison for their roles in a 2022 Iran-backed assassination plot targeting Iranian-American journalist and dissident Masih Alinejad. The men, linked to an Eastern European criminal gang and contracted by an Iranian Revolutionary Guards brigadier general, were convicted of murder for hire, conspiracy, money laundering, and firearm possession. Authorities intercepted the assassination attempt when a hired gunman was arrested near Alinejad's Brooklyn home with a loaded weapon. Alinejad, a vocal critic of Iran’s regime and advocate for women’s rights, praised the U.S. justice system for standing against political repression, emphasizing that her activism was her only 'crime.' Despite the defendants' lawyers seeking leniency, the judge condemned the assassination attempt as politically motivated and a serious crime against freedom of expression. The case highlights ongoing U.S. efforts to counter transnational repression by authoritarian regimes.
